Quick Guide to Alerts, Thresholds,
Risk Scores and Response Actions
CUSTOMER SUCCESS TRAINING
You ask, we deliver. Alerting was one of the most requested topics during the previous customer training, so this educational session covers how to make the most of this valuable Netwrix Auditor feature.
Assign scores to alerts to spot the high-risk users in your IT environment
By the end of the session, you’ll know how to:
Set up alerts on critical actions, threshold-based alerts and alerts based on search
Make sure your alerts deliver useful insights that enable quick response
Add a script to an alert that will automatically disable the user account displaying the suspicious activity
Further customize the alert to subsequently trigger an ad-hoc AV scan on a particular resource
